Factors associated with carotid artery calcification in the general working-age population
Aim. To study factors associated with carotid artery calcification as an atherosclerotic marker in the general working-age population.Material and methods. The data of a representative ESSE-RF sample aged 25-64 years (n=1412) were studied. They underwent standard cardiology screening and assessment...
